Seroprevalence study in forestry workers of a non-endemic region in eastern Germany reveals infections by Tula and Dobrava–Belgrade hantaviruses

Abstract: Highly endemic and outbreak regions for human hantavirus infections are located in the southern, southeastern, and western parts of Germany. The dominant hantavirus is the bank vole transmitted Puumala virus (PUUV). In the eastern part of Germany, previous investigations revealed Tula virus (TULV) and Dobrava-Belgrade virus (DOBV) infections in the respective rodent reservoirs. “…German researchers examined for hantaviruses (serotype Dobrava/ Tula) a population of 563 forestry workers from the southern regions of Germany. Serologic tests showed 9.1% of positive results (Mertens et al 2011). Another study concerned a group of 722 forestry workers from Germany, from the region of North Rhine-Westphalia, in whom 6% of positive results were confirmed (for serotype Puumala) (Jurke et al 2015).…”

“…A 5.88% seroprevalence was detected in the eastern part of the country [24]. In Germany, a corresponding work was carried out in the north-eastern Brandenburg territory, revealing that among a total of 563 tested persons, 9% proved to be seropositive against DOBV, PUUV and TULV [28]. In Switzerland, the assaying of 1693 farmers, forestry workers, young soldiers and blood donors showed low seroprevalence rates with a maximum of 1.9%.…”

“…Hunters and forestry workers represent a risk population for hantavirus infections due to their increased exposure to various rodents carrying different pathogenic hantavirus species. Studies focusing on hantavirus seroprevalence in this risk population were carried out in several European countries, including Slovakia, Poland, Switzerland and Germany [24][25][26][27][28]. This occupational risk has not been systematically investigated in Hungary; hence, we aimed to study hantavirus infections by demonstrating DOBV and PUUV specific antibodies in serum samples of hunters and forestry workers.…”
